Screen Resolution Problem

I have a HP w17e Widescreen CD monitor and an Intel 82945G Express Chipset Graphics Card.
The monitor has a native resolution of 1440x900 and I've been using that resolution for a few months already(It's a new computer).
Just yesterday, I installed the Sony "Picture Motion Browser" for Handycam and Ubuntu Gusty Gibbon 7.10

When I booted back into windows, the system was in 1280x768 and 1440x900 is not available. Now I'm running in 1600x900 but I prefer to use the native resolution. Also, If I open the monitor menu, it says "Running in 1440x900"

Any help would be seful.

Re: Screen Resolution Problem

I would right click that entry and choose Uninstall then reboot.

If the uninstall blacks out the screen just restart from the power button.

This will see if Vista will re-recognize the proper device.

Your specific monitor should be listed there.
